The Irish traveled to Hollister to take on the Tigers under new coach Rich Adkins. The Irish were trying to bounce back after a tough road loss against Cassville.

The Irish got to work quick, starting from their own 15 and covering the remaining 85 yards with 16 running plays. The Defense took over forcing a 3 and out for the Tigers and took possession on their own 40 for the second drive of the quarter. The Irish went back to their ground attack with an series of runs from Hunter Brown, Nick Crites, Adrian Coulter, and Zack Gebhard. Tyson Riley capped the 6:14 drive with a scamper from 9 yards that put the Irish up 14-0 with 10 minutes left in the half. 

The Irish continued to control the ball and the clock and added a 3rd touchdown by Nick Crites from 16-yards out to put the Irish up 21-0. This lead would carry them through to halftime. 

The Irish picked up where they left off in the 3rd quarter continuing to stifle the Tigers on Defense and adding two more scores from Tyson Riley and Nick Crites. The Irish defense also played big on the night holding the Tigers to 143 yards from scrimmage and only 7 first downs. Sacks were also registered by Tyler Welch (2) and Kye Alms.
